The 2026 Owala Color Drop phenomenon
I have tracked the rise of the Owala FreeSip 32oz for several years, but the 2026 limited edition Color Drops have reached a new level of intensity. These releases are more than just water bottles; they are highly sought-after collector items that frequently sell out within minutes of appearing on the US website. I find that the appeal lies in the unique color palettes that are never reproduced once the drop ends.
For my readers in Australia, the challenge is two-fold. First, these exclusive designs are rarely released directly in the Australian market. Second, the time difference and shipping logistics often prevent local fans from securing a bottle before the US inventory is depleted. I believe that understanding the logistics of US acquisition is essential for any serious collector who wants to avoid the secondary resale market.

Overcoming US checkout blocks with BuyForMe
I often encounter a significant hurdle when shopping at major US retailers: the payment block. Some US stores, such as Nike, Sephora, Apple, or even specific sporting goods outlets, often block international credit cards or decline orders sent to known shipping hubs. I have seen many Australian orders cancelled at the last second because the store's fraud filter flagged a non-US billing address.

The math of importing versus local Australian resale
I want to break down why I believe this strategy is the "Smart Shopper" choice for 2026. A limited Owala FreeSip 32oz typically retails for $37.99 USD. When I add international shipping fees of approximately $28 USD and the mandatory GST for ship to Australia orders, the total landed cost is roughly $102 AUD.
| Item | Estimated Cost (AUD) |
|---|---|
| Owala FreeSip 32oz (MSRP) | $58.00 |
| Shipping & Handling | $44.00 |
| Total Landed Cost | $102.00 |
| Australian Resale Price | $165.00+ |
My analysis shows a clear saving of over $60 AUD per bottle compared to buying from local resellers who inflate prices due to scarcity.
